The book’s strength lies in its comprehensive and detailed coverage of both core ecological principles and pressing environmental issues. It adheres to the curriculum guidelines of the University Grants Commission (UGC), making it directly relevant to university students, while its depth makes it an invaluable resource for aspirants of the Union Public Service Commission (UPSC) exams.
